Web10 apr 2024 · The routes that the refugees have taken to Tijuana are bizarre. After leaving Ukraine, Roman Biloskalenko, a Nikopol employee, passed through the airports of Warsaw, Zurich, Madrid and Bogotá before making two stops in Mexico, in Cancún and Guadalajara.
